IDEALE PER: multiuso, progetti fai-da-te, uso di attrezzi, paesaggistica, demolizione, costruzione, scherma, funzionamento di attrezzature, giardinaggio e altro!. POLSO ELASTICO: Tiene fuori sporco e detriti mantenendo il guanto aderente al polso. POLSINO: protezione del polso fornita da polsino di sicurezza per impieghi gravosi. PELLE COMPLETA: palmo, punta delle dita e nocche sono coperti e protetti da questa pelle resistente. DOVUTO PESANTE: la pelle di maiale ha una maggiore resistenza all'abrasione, alla perforazione e all'acqua rispetto ad altre pelli.

Durable and comfortable gloves
I've used a LOT of gloves over the years. There's nothing more frustrating than to spend $40 on a pair of gloves and have them fail after a few hours work. As an example of what I need gloves for: I cut about 3 cords per year of eucalyptus wood on our property with hand tools. (This may include digging out large stumps of dead trees over the period of several weeks part time.) Dry eucalyptus has large, sharp "shards" when you split it, which put a beating on ordinary gloves. Also, I recently took apart a large brick counter-top on our patio and removed Spanish tile from the cement underneath which destroyed a nice pair of Stanley gloves in a few hours. I don't even look at those cheap leather gloves from the home outlet stores; they would be shredded after an hour or two, but these pigskin Wells Lamont 3300L gloves hold up very well. The leather on these gloves is supple yet thick enough to hold up under stress. I have not had the stitching fail yet--see below now. I'm going to buy these gloves exclusively from now on. ************ 1 Year Later: I took one star off this review. After writing the above, the next pair of these gloves were not the same quality. The stitching in the palm failed after a week of light garden use which is a simple quality control issue that Wells Lamont needs to fix. ************ I am purchasing another pair of these gloves from Amazon today. I still give them four stars and they are very good gloves. HOWEVER, expect them to develop holes in the fingers and (occasionally) the thumb if you work hard with them. I use them for all sorts of projects here on the ranch and a lot for cutting wood with saw and axe. My solution? The foundation of Western Civilization: DUCT TAPE! Makes them last for six months more. See pictures.
